Output e609f12ab80e44efd6d02bc757d1036f89e317516fd99cc3e2e3f4110367cf9b:0

value
8620142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cd5a64e7079b9e8864604e37d1a7cc49d31f88 OP_EQUAL
address
3JzbdyzLcBVfETY4Uu5YBaSVB6NyU4H3dc
transaction
e609f12ab80e44efd6d02bc757d1036f89e317516fd99cc3e2e3f4110367cf9b
confirmations
496744
spent
true